WebThe Caribbean and South America. Besides ruling the 13 colonies of North America, England settled other parts of the New World. In the Caribbean, the English colonized the Leeward Islands of Antigua, St. Kitts, Nevis, and Barbados between 1609 and 1632 and seized Jamaica from the Spanish in 1655. WebNov 6, 2024 · The British Empire settled its first permanent colony in the Americas at Jamestown, Virginia, in 1607. This was the first of 13 coloniesin North America. The 13 Original U.S. Colonies The 13 coloniescan be divided into three regions: New England, Middle, and Southern colonies. Web(See Latin America, history of .) A colonial period of nearly three centuries followed the major Spanish conquests. The empire was created in a time of rising European absolutism, which flourished in both Spain and Spanish America and reached its height in the 18th century. The overseas colonies became and remained the king’s private estate. WebJun 9, 2024 · Over the next century, the English established a total of 13 colonies.
